Job description

Our client is a highly reputable civil engineering and groundworks contractor working with residential developers across the South of England. They cover a range of aspect of civil engineering, from bulk excavations to complex civil structures. They are looking for an experienced Quantity Surveyor/ Estimator to join their team in Ringwood, to carry out groundworks and civil engineering surveying and estimating for new housing projects, reporting to the Commercial Director.

You will receive company specific training and support, ensuring that the standard of work produced is not only to the standards required by the client, but meets local and national standard.

Main Responsibilities
  • Point of contact for all surveying / estimating queries, concerns, or actions on a project.
  • Ensure the company is aware/ complies fully with its contractual responsibilities.
  • Assisting in preparation, submission and agreement of contract tenders/ submissions.
  • Working with the surveying/ estimating teams with preparation, submission and agreement of project variations, claims and design changes.
  • Preparation of project forecasts and cost plans.
  • Comply with company and departmental procedures and deadlines.
  • Prepare and submit accurate reports that analyse and demonstrate the profitability and commercial progress of a project.
  • Work in collaboration with procurement and site management teams.
Requirements
  • You must be able to demonstrate 5+ years in Surveying of UK residential groundworks projects.
  • Strong numerical and analytical skills.
  • Advance use of Microsoft Excel and Word.
  • Working knowledge of Bluebeam of similar construction software.
